Output 65ca4626a0fbb81f315b92885021b0032375a36194c880d5f8754ae8c4597426:1

value
552951
script pubkey
OP_0 OP_PUSHBYTES_20 6824d68adcbb0cef6c5d37878a5c0972abdbfeaa
address
bc1qdqjddzkuhvxw7mzax7rc5hqfw24ahl42zzg8z7
transaction
65ca4626a0fbb81f315b92885021b0032375a36194c880d5f8754ae8c4597426